In-Store Stimuli and Impulsive Buying Behaviour

Abstract

The objective of this article is to investigate the influence of retail shopping environment and impulsive buying tendency on unplanned buying. With this objective, this research examines how display of the goods inside the store, appearance and helpfulness of store employees and crowd inside the retail store affect impulsive buying and such buying tendency among Indian shoppers. Using multiple regression analysis, it is observed that retail shopping environment considerably influences the impulsive buying tendency of the shoppers and this tendency leads to spontaneous buying. The results reveal that retail shopping environment and consumer impulse buying tendency encourage impulse buying positively. In addition, it is found that store employees have no influence on impulse buying tendency among Indian shoppers.
